Position Summary:
The Senior Producer will provide leadership for recording, editing and other elements required in the production of two podcasts for More Than Just Stories, Goshen College’s five-year storytelling initiative on Christian faith and life funded by the Lilly Endowment. This person will work closely with the project director and other faculty colleagues in the Communication Department and the Religion, Justice, and Society Department in contributing to the various projects and activities of More Than Just Stories, which also includes a speech contest, a documentary and a storytelling festival. The senior producer will manage production of the two podcasts, Just Stories and Gratitude Letters, from initial concept to final delivery, with steps that include researching, pre-interviewing, recording and editing. The successful candidate will have experience in using advanced audio and video tools for storytelling in multiple media formats. Beyond these media production responsibilities, this person will be engaged in many elements of the storytelling initiative, including events on and off campus, workshops and staff meetings. Opportunity to teach up to two undergraduate courses each year in the Communication Department, depending on departmental need and personal qualifications. This person will supervise the content production manager and student staff contributing to the podcasting projects. This position requires a creative, self-motivated professional with excellent communication, technical and organizational skills. Attention to details and deadlines is crucial.
